综述:具有抗单纯疱疹病毒活性的全植物提取物的体内外研究

Review of Whole Plant Extracts With Activity Against Herpes Simplex Viruses In Vitro and In Vivo.

Abstract

Herpes simplex viruses, HSV-1 and HSV-2, are highly contagious and cause lifelong, latent infections with recurrent outbreaks of oral and/or genital lesions. No cure exists for HSV-1 or HSV-2 infections, but antiviral medications are commonly used to prevent and treat outbreaks. Resistance to antivirals has begun to emerge, placing an importance on finding new and effective therapies for prophylaxis and treatment of HSV outbreaks. Botanicals may be effective HSV therapies as the constituents they contain act through a variety of mechanisms, potentially making the development of antiviral resistance more challenging. A wide variety of plants from different regions in the world have been studied for antiviral activity against HSV-1 and/or HSV-2 and showed efficacy of varying degrees. The purpose of this review is to summarize research conducted on whole plant extracts against HSV-1 and/or HSV-2 in vitro and in vivo. The majority of the research reviewed was conducted in vitro using animal cell lines, and some studies used an animal model design. Also summarized are a limited number of human trials conducted using botanical therapies on HSV lesions.

摘要

单纯疱疹病毒 1 型(HSV-1)和 2 型(HSV-2)具有高度传染性,可导致终生潜伏感染,并反复发作口腔和/或生殖器病变。目前尚无治愈 HSV-1 或 HSV-2 感染的方法,但抗病毒药物常用于预防和治疗发作。对抗病毒药物的耐药性已开始出现,因此寻找新的有效的预防和治疗 HSV 发作的疗法非常重要。植物药可能是有效的 HSV 治疗方法,因为它们所含的成分通过多种机制发挥作用,这可能使抗病毒耐药性的发展更加具有挑战性。来自世界各地不同地区的多种植物已被研究用于对抗 HSV-1 和/或 HSV-2 的抗病毒活性,并显示出不同程度的疗效。本综述的目的是总结针对 HSV-1 和/或 HSV-2 的全植物提取物的体外和体内研究。综述的大部分研究是在使用动物细胞系进行的体外进行的,一些研究使用了动物模型设计。还总结了少数使用植物疗法治疗 HSV 病变的人体临床试验。
